1What is the typical cost range for professional cabinet installation in Rockbridge Baths, and what factors influence the price?

In the Rockbridge Baths and surrounding Shenandoah Valley area, profess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$1,500 to $5,000+ for a standard kitchen, with labor averaging $50 to $100 per hour. Key cost factors include the complexity of the layout (common in older homes), whether you provide RTA (ready-to-assemble) versus custom-built cabinets, and the need for any structural modifications to walls or floors. Local material and fuel surcharges for travel to more rural properties can also affect the final quote.

2How does the local climate in Rockbridge County affect cabinet installation and material choices?

Rockbridge Baths experiences humid summers and variable winter humidity, which can cause wood to expand and contract. We recommend selecting cabinet materials and finishes stable for Virginia's climate, such as quarter-sawn wood or high-quality plywood boxes, and ensuring your installer properly acclimates cabinets to your home's interior for 48-72 hours before installation. Proper sealing and finishing are critical to protect against moisture, especially for kitchens and bathrooms.

3Are there specific permits or regulations in Rockbridge County I need to be aware of for a cabinet installation project?

For a straightforward cabinet replacement, a permit is usually not required in unincorporated Rockbridge County. However, if your installation involves significant electrical rewiring, plumbing relocation for sinks/dishwashers, or structural wall modifications, you may need permits from the Rockbridge County Building Inspection Office. A reputable local installer will know when permits are necessary and can often handle the process for you, ensuring compliance with Virginia Uniform Statewide Building Code (USBC).

4What should I look for when choosing a cabinet installer in the Rockbridge area, and are there local seasonal timing considerations?

Seek installers with verifiable local references and experience with the mix of historic and modern homes found in the area. Check for proper licensing (Class C contractor's license in Virginia) and insurance. Regarding timing, late spring through early fall is ideal for installation due to easier travel and open-window ventilation for finishes, but schedule well in advance as local tradespeople are often booked months ahead, especially for whole-kitchen remodels.

5My home has uneven floors or walls, which is common in older Rockbridge Baths houses. Will this be a problem for cabinet installation?

This is a very common concern for local homeowners. Experienced installers expect and are skilled at handling out-of-plumb walls and unlevel floors, which are typical in older Virginia homes. They will use professional shimming and scribing techniques to ensure your cabinets are installed level and plumb, creating a seamless finished look. Discuss this directly with any potential installer to confirm their expertise with these specific challenges.
